Title: | LAMP BRONEER TYPE XXVIII | |
Category Code: | L | |
Object Number: | 1575 | |
Description: | Lamp wtih leaf-shaped flat bottom, shallow flaring body, broad sloping rim, plastic ring framing disk but broken by 2 grooves framing nozzle; shallow concave disk with central fill hole, air hole at edge of disk with incised line to wick hole; nozzle enclosed in body, large wick hole. Solid lug handle interrupted by mould seam. | |
Decoration: | Bottom: incised branch, 2 grooves, 2 holes at base of handle, 1 below nozzle. Rim: herringbone; disk: shell. Handle: 2 grooves to base. | |
Material: | Moderatley fine brown clay wtih frequent tiny and few fine white inclusions, rare round red inclusions. | |
Munsell Color: | 5YR 4/4 | |
Condition: | Complete or intact. Intact. Burning on nozzle. | |
Manufacture: | MM | |
Dimensions Actual: | L00.090 H00.030 (rim) H00.042 (max) W00.067 | |
Period: | Late Roman (5th -6th c AD) | |
